Maintenance Planner
Our client, a leader in industrial manufacturing, is seeking a Maintenance Planner to join their team. As a Maintenance Planner, you will be part of the maintenance department supporting operational efficiency. The ideal candidate will have strong communication skills, proficiency in planning and organization, and familiarity with industrial manufacturing equipment, which will align successfully in the organization. **Job Title:** Maintenance Planner **Location:** Colonial Heights, VA **Pay Range:** Up to $40/hr **What's the Job?** + Responsible for the planning of maintenance repair and reliability work using SAP Notifications and Work Order Processes. + Oversee all aspects of maintenance planning including material selection, procurement, and purchases. + Set deadlines, assign responsibilities, and monitor and summarize progress of work orders. + Prepare reports for upper management regarding status of work orders via schedule attainment and craftsperson backlog. + Lead and direct the work of others while relying on extensive experience and judgment to accomplish goals. **What's Needed?** + Proficiency in SAP and Office 365. + Experience with industrial manufacturing equipment and maintenance planning + Strong verbal and written communication skills, particularly with digital documentation. + Planning and organization skills in maintenance planning, project planning, or equivalent. + A bachelor's degree and at least 4-6 years of experience in the field or a related area. **What's in it for me?** + Opportunity for a TEMP to HIRE role with potential for career growth. + Work in a collaborative environment with a focus on innovation and efficiency. + Gain experience in a dynamic industrial setting. + Contribute to the planning and execution of critical maintenance operations. + Engage in a role that values creativity and problem-solving.
